Branch cut for stable/aluminium stream
[releng/builder.git] / jjb / netvirt / netvirt.yaml
index c132094708e9dffd9981dac42e178f83434e50cf..11ee0f7c2bbb84421e7a68a6ce41fc3153db8259 100644 (file)
@@ -1,4 +1,44 @@
 ---
+- project:
+    name: netvirt-silicon
+    jobs:
+      - '{project-name}-distribution-check-{stream}'
+      - '{project-name}-maven-javadoc-jobs'
+      - '{project-name}-rtd-jobs':
+          build-node: centos7-builder-2c-2g
+          doc-dir: .tox/docs/tmp/html
+          project-pattern: netvirt
+          rtd-build-url: https://readthedocs.org/api/v2/webhook/odl-netvirt/32929/
+          rtd-token: 7b6a1dcfc729957ace511e016274e253e07a8d6c
+      - gerrit-tox-verify
+      - odl-maven-jobs-jdk11
+      - odl-maven-verify-jobs
+
+    csit-gate-list: 'netvirt-csit-1node-0cmb-1ctl-2cmp-apex-queens-gate-snat-conntrack-{stream}'
+    block_on_csit: false
+
+    stream: silicon
+    branch: 'master'
+
+    project: 'netvirt'
+    project-name: 'netvirt'
+
+    java-version: 'openjdk11'
+    mvn-settings: 'netvirt-settings'
+    mvn-opts: '-Xmx2048m'
+    build-timeout: 90
+    build-node: centos7-builder-8c-8g
+    dependencies: >
+        genius-merge-{stream},
+        neutron-merge-{stream},
+        openflowjava-merge-{stream},
+        openflowplugin-merge-{stream},
+        ovsdb-merge-{stream}
+    email-upstream: '[genius] [netvirt] [neutron] [openflowjava] [openflowplugin] [ovsdb]'
+
+    # Used by the release job
+    staging-profile-id: a67da0ffbb1ba
+
 - project:
     name: netvirt-aluminium
     jobs:
@@ -18,7 +58,7 @@
     block_on_csit: false
 
     stream: aluminium
-    branch: 'master'
+    branch: 'stable/aluminium'
 
     project: 'netvirt'
     project-name: 'netvirt'